What You Should Prepare Before Applying For Refund
Account Information: Your MTEL account number and registered email address associated with the account.
Transaction ID: The unique transaction ID for the purchase you wish to refund.
Proof of Purchase: A copy of the invoice or confirmation email that includes details of the purchase.
Reason for Refund: A clear explanation of why you are requesting the refund, adhering to MTEL's refund policy.
Service Details: Information about the specific service or product, including package type and activation date.
Contact Records: Any prior correspondence with MTEL customer service regarding this transaction.
Identification: A government-issued ID to verify your identity if required.
Billing Information: The last four digits of the payment method used for the transaction.
Delay Documents: If applicable, any documentation regarding service outages or delays that supports your refund request.

What are my Rights? Am I eligible for a Refund from MTEL Switzerland
At MTEL Switzerland, users have certain rights concerning their subscription services, which are primarily focused on mobile and internet communication solutions. Understanding these rights, especially in the context of billing and eligibility for refunds, can help users manage their accounts more effectively.
The eligibility for refunds typically arises from specific account management and service experiences. Here are some situations that may qualify users for a refund from MTEL Switzerland:
Service Interruptions: If users experience frequent or prolonged service interruptions that prevent access to paid features, they might be eligible for a refund for the impacted period.
Subscription Downgrades: Users who downgrade their subscription plan may have the remaining balance of their previous higher-tier plan refunded, depending on the timing of the downgrade.
Promotional Pricing Discrepancies: If a user enrolled in a promotional offer and it was not applied correctly, adjustments may be available to align with the initial promotional agreement.
Account Closure: If a user decides to close their account and has paid in advance for services beyond the closure date, a refund for the unused services may be provided.
Service Plan Changes: If a user transitions to a different service plan and the billing does not reflect the agreed-upon terms, they may be eligible for a refund for discrepancies.
It’s important for users to review their account and billing statements carefully to identify any situations that might qualify for a refund based on the circumstances outlined above. Step-by-Step Process to Request Your MTEL Switzerland Refund Like a Pro
Log in to your account using your email and password.
Navigate to the My Account section.
Click on Billing History to find your recent transactions.
Locate the relevant charge and click on it for more details.
Look for a Request a Refund option and select it.
Fill out the refund request form:
Mention that the subscription renewed without notice.
Emphasize that the account was unused during the billing period.
Submit the form and save a confirmation of your request.
If you purchased through Apple:
Open the Settings app on your iPhone or iPad.
Tap your Apple ID at the top of the screen.
Select Subscriptions.
Find your MTEL subscription and tap on it.
Scroll down and select Report a Problem.
Follow the prompts to select the reason for your refund:
Choose Item didn't work as expected.
Mention that the subscription renewed without notice.
Complete the steps to submit your refund request.
If you purchased through Google Play:
Open the Google Play Store app on your device.
Tap on your Profile Icon in the top right corner.
Select Payments & Subscriptions.
Tap on Subscriptions and find your MTEL subscription.
Press Manage, then select Refund.
Choose a reason:
Select Service not as described.
Mention that the subscription renewed without notice.
Submit your refund request.
If you purchased through Roku:
Go to the Roku website and sign in to your account.
Navigate to Manage Account.
Select Subscriptions on the left menu.
Find your MTEL subscription and click on it.
Follow the link to Request a Refund.
In the refund reason, indicate:
Choose Service was not received.
Mention that the account was unused.
Complete and submit the refund request.

How to Track Your Refund Status Efficiently
Tracking your refund status with MTEL Switzerland is straightforward and efficient. By utilizing the various tools and notifications provided, you can stay informed about the progress of your refund. Here are some specific tips for monitoring your refund status:
Check Your Email: MTEL Switzerland sends out regular email updates regarding your refund status. Look for emails titled "Refund Update" or "Your MTEL Refund Process" to receive timely notifications.
Use the MTEL Account Dashboard: Log in to your MTEL account and navigate to the Order History section. Here, you'll find details about your refund request, including its current status and any relevant dates.
Mobile App Notifications: If you have the MTEL mobile app, ensure that push notifications are enabled. You will receive real-time updates on your refund status directly through the app, making it easy to keep track on the go.
Billing Section Insights: Within your account settings, visit the Billing section for a summary of all transactions, including refund information. This section provides a detailed view of when your refund was initiated and its expected processing time.
Contact Customer Support: If you require further assistance, feel free to reach out to MTEL's customer support. They can provide specific details about your refund status that may not be available in your account dashboard.
